-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
回顾: 1. VB 的赋值语句 变量名 = 表达式 功 能:将右边的表达式的值赋给左边的变量 2.输入数据的函数: inputbox(提示信息,标题,默认值,位置 ) 功 能:提供从键盘输入数据的函数 3.输出数据的方法: Print 输出内容 功 能:将计算出来的值输出到窗体上。 1:写出下列语句。 (1)将数值123赋给变量A。 (2)将变量B的值赋给变量A。 (3)将变量A的值加上10后,再赋给变量A。 2:写出以下程序段的运行结果 N=0 M=1 N=N+1 M=M*N X=M Print x=;x 3:判断以下式子在赋值语句中是否正确 D=6+9 F+3=E+6 G=G*4 X*Y=Z 观摩: 4、若A=5,B=3,则执行下面的语句: (1)Print a=; a, b=; b (2) Print a=; a; b=; b (3) Print a=; a, Print b=; b (4) Print a=; a Print b=; b 深入探讨顺序结构 观察一段程序: Private Sub Command1_Click() Const PI As Single = 3.14 Dim r As Single, s As Single r = InputBox(r=, 输入半径) s = PI * r * r Print 圆的面积s=; s End Sub 程序的顺序结构运行流程图 已知长方体的长、宽、高,编写一个程序,求长方体的全面积和体积。 例题: 从键盘上输入一个三位整数,然后将它反向输出。例如输入456,输出应为654。 (2)设计算法 ①输入x的值; ②计算:x1=x\100; ③计算:x2=(x-x1*100)\10 ④计算:x3=x-x1*100-x2*10 ⑤计算:y=x3*100+x2*10+x1 ⑥输出y的值 Private Sub Command1_Click() x = InputBox(x=, 输入) x1 = x \ 100 x2 = (x - x1 * 100) \ 10 x3 = x - x1 * 100 - x2 * 10 y = x3 * 100 + x2 * 10 + x1 Print y=; y End Sub 课堂任务 1、试编写一个程序,实现输入圆的半径,输出 圆的周长和面积。 dim r as single dim s as single dim l as single r = inputbox(r= , 输入半径) s = 3.14 * r * r l = 2*3.14*r print 圆的面积s=; s print 圆的周长l=; l Private Sub Command1_Click() v0 = 40 a = 0.15 t = 2 v = v0 + a * t s = v0 * t + a * t ^ 2 / 2 Print v=; v Print s=; s End Sub * * A=123 A=B A=A+10 X=1 √×√× F3=E+6 XY=Z 开始 语句1 语句2 …… 结束 语句N 只有一个入口 只有一个出口 Dim a As Single, b As Single, c As Single, s As Single, v As Single a = Val(InputBox(a=, a)) b = Val(InputBox(b=, b)) c = Val(InputBox(c=, c)) s = 2 * (a * b + a * c + b * c) v = a * b * c Print s=; s, v=; v Print s=; s; v=; v 分析问题: 设x为输入的三位整数,y为x的反向输出。x的百位x1、十位x2、个位x3分别为: x1=x\100 x2=(x-x1*100)\10 x3=x-x1*100-x2*10 y=x3*100+x2*10+x1 2、一列火车在某地时的时速为v0=40km/h,现以加速度a=0.15m/s2加速行驶,试编写一个程序,求2min后的速度v和距开始点的距离s。
您可能关注的文档
- 2020版新教材高中生物课堂检测素养达标5.4光合作用与能量转化(二)(含解析)新人教版必修.doc
- 2020版新教材高中生物课堂检测素养达标6.2细胞的分化(含解析)新人教版必修1.doc
- 2020版新教材高中生物课堂检测素养达标6.3细胞的衰老和死亡(含解析)新人教版必修1.doc
- 801文化墙板块简介定稿.ppt
- 25 古人谈读书【交互版】.ppt
- 27 我的“长生果”【护眼版】.ppt
- 5.1让友谊之树长青.ppt
- Unit 1 Where did you go on vacation基础知识复习小测(含答案).ppt
- 6 将相和【护眼版】.ppt
- 7 什么比猎豹的速度更快【护眼版】.ppt
最近下载
- 1桌签格式.doc VIP
- 丰富多彩的中华传统体育+课件 2025-2026学年人教版(2024)初中体育与健康八年级全一册.pptx VIP
- XX能源公司XX风电场×MW工程建设管理制度汇编(总承包项目部)完整版.doc
- 2020抽水蓄能电站施工设计方案.pdf VIP
- 儿童糖尿病酮症酸中毒诊疗指南(2024).pptx VIP
- 虚拟电厂管理平台需求及设计-方案合集.docx VIP
- 茶饮料灭菌技术概述.pdf VIP
- 2025新高考高一函数定义域值域解析式易错培优竞赛试题(解析板).docx
- 常用NTC47KΩ阻值B=3950阻温R-T对照表.pdf VIP
- 歌曲《我和我的祖国》课件.pptx
文档评论(0)